Lightened up Rich Chocolate Pudding
- 1 tablespoon stevia, liquid
- 13 cup cornstarch
- 14 teaspoon salt
- 3 ounces unsweetened chocolate, cut up
- 3 cups skim milk
- 1 12 teaspoons vanilla
- whipped cream, to garnish
- Combine stevia, cornstarch, salt and chocolate in a medium bowl; gradually stir in milk.
- Cook 2 min in microwave, stirring after each time of cooking, until chocolate melts and mixture is thickening; Remove from heat, and stir in vanilla.
- Pour into a 3 cup jello mold; cover with plastic wrap and refrigerate until cold, about 3 hours.
- When ready to serve, run a knife around the top, dip mold quickly in and out of hot water, then invert on a serving plate.
- Garnish with whipped cream if desired.
